Now, it's a bit more complicated than that so we'd like to give you a basic outline of why pre-emergent ...The herbicides are applied to your lawn and then (typically) watered in. The herbicide will penetrate the top inch or two of the soil, forming a protective barrier. In the spring as the ground heats up and weeds begin to germinate, the weeds will hit the pre-emergent barrier in the soil and die. To continue the clarification, granular pre-emergents come two ways: standalone, and combination (pre-mixed) with turfgrass fertilizer. The standalone type contains ONLY the pre-emergent herbicide, whereas the combination type contains both the herbicide and turfgrass fertilizer.Feb 02, 2021. Pre-emergent herbicides are products that prevent the germinating weeds from establishing in the lawn. They control annual grassy weeds (think crabgrass) by inhibiting cell division in the young root system. Fertilizers provide essential nutrients that help grass...When considering the use of pre-emergents, refer to the following guidelines: Spring Pre-Emergents should be applied when the soil temperature has been at 55℉ (12℃) for 2–3 days. Fall Pre-Emergents should be applied when soil temperatures come down to 70℉ (21℃) for 2–3 days. As food weblog Serious Eats points out, composting used coffee grounds is a great way to star...That is a cost of $3.99 per 1,000 sq ft. 5 oz bottle - $24.48 covers 27,000 sq ft. That is a cost of 91 cents per 1,000 sq ft. The liquid version is MUCH MUCH cheaper. This is why professional lawn companies almost always try to spray their liquid prodiamine rather than apply granular. Best Budget: Hi-Yield 33030 Pre-Emergent Herbicide. “Comes in a bulk size of 12 pounds with a reasonable price, great for home lawns.”.Here’s all you need to know for the metro Atlanta area: Typically, apply fall pre-emergent between Sept. 1 and Oct. 1 to control winter weeds. Specifically, apply when soil temperature at 2″ is 70 degrees and declining. Check your soil temperature here. Fertilizer-crabgrass preventer (pre-emergent) combinations contain a weed preventer specifically targeting the tiny seedlings of warm season annual grasses (crabgrass and yellow foxtail). The weed preventer works as the grasses just emerge from the seed, but before they are visible above ground. Oct 25, 2021 ...
